Hey guys... I had the same problem yesterday and after researching for like hours, I came across a solution that actually worked for me...

You have to unroot your NOTE to a gingerbread version using ODIN..

After that you can upgrade to ICS through the software update from the phone.

It took me around 3 hours cause I had to download the gingerbread 2.3.6 version (~550mb), Samsung Kies, Odin and then unroot, factory reset and then update my phone around 3-4 times to get the final ICS update.

Download:
Gingerbread Link: [STOCK ROMS] N7000 All stock ROMs + install + Root guide All at 1place,Latest ICS LQ3 - xda-developers (Select appropriate link based on region, only the 2.3.X versions)

Odin: Download Tools/ODIN/Odin3v185.zip at StockROMs.net

Kies: Download Samsung/Kies_2.0.3.11082_152_4.exe at DownloadAndroidROM.com

Step 1: Download from all of the above links and unzip. Install Kies if not done so in order for your pc to detect your phone.

Step 2: Put your Galaxy Note into download mode by holding down the Volume Down, Center button, and the Power button together for about 10 seconds. Then press volume up when you see the warning sign. Connect it to your computer.

Step 3: Run Odin

Ya I tried it on my note and its working just fine. Dont't worry about it, I was a beginner as well. I read that the only ROM's that were safe for NOTE are the gingerbread ROM's. If you flash an ICS ROM, then you wont be able to factory reset or anything like that as there is a great chance for you NOTE to brick.

And about the updating part - After you finish the above steps, you'll be on gingerbread. So just update your phone manually. For me, samsung(My Phone) asked me to update so I kept on doing that until I was from gingerbread to ICS(there are like 3-4 updates in between). I was also asked to update that "7 Mb" file(after installing ICS), which led to this problem of hanging on the samsung logo. Dont do that update. After updating to ICS, turn off the automatic software update option. You'll know that you are on ICS as it is a big update of >300mb.

I also emailed samsung about the situation and all they told me was to see the samsung store so ya, it just better to do it my way.

Hope this helps!!! Good Luck guys!!! (oh ya... You need a windows pc, I have done mine on a mac but I have a windows 7 partition which i find quite useful sometimes)

Fixed:

Further explanation to kurivellam's note:

go to:

http://forum.xda-developers.com/showthread.php?t=1424997

And download the correct ICS for your region. I download the following:

N7000DDLP8-------4.0.3-----------2012 May-----------N7000ODDLP5-------------India----- -------------------------------Download

Then follow step 1.b from the following:

http://forum.xda-developers.com/showpost.php?p=26455511&postcount=2475

Just one addition:

ID com port shud turn yellow (not shown in image) (To get it to turn yellow click on the field before hitting start) Please note if ID com port is not yellow it won't work.

Now click start and claim your Note back.

Also note that I did not loose any data so you are safe to follow the above.
